The Spanish Film Academy opens applications for the 2025-2026 Residency Program, aimed at filmmakers developing audiovisual projects with a strong connection to Madrid.

A total of 20 projects will be selected, providing financial support, personalized mentorship from industry professionals, and a dedicated workspace at the Academy’s headquarters. Participants will also have access to training sessions and networking events organized by the Academy and Madrid City Council.

The program lasts nine months (from October 2025 to June 2026) and is open to both Spanish and international creators.

The LATINX 2025 Latin American Argument Contest, organized by the Latin American Training Center (LATC), targets emerging screenwriters, students, and recent graduates from Latin America with no produced feature films. The call accepts up to 3-page synopses for fiction or documentary feature films centered on the theme “Latin American Places.” Applications are open until July 2, 2025, with various fees and discounts for diversity and inclusion groups, as well as a social fee waiver option. Prizes include cash awards, coaching sessions with renowned screenwriter Kate Lyra, Final Draft software licenses, and books. The jury comprises distinguished film and drama professionals from Brazil and Peru. This contest offers a great chance for new Latin American talent to advance their projects and gain specialized mentorship.

The Rueda Film Academy Program is aimed at emerging or professional screenwriters (individuals), of legal age at the time the application is submitted, of any nationality, whether national or foreign, who present initiatives focused on the development of projects, in feature film format and of any genre (fiction, documentary or animation).

The CIBEF International Screenwriting Residency 2025 will take place in Lima, Peru, from May 27 to June 7, 2025. This program is aimed at emerging screenwriters from Ibero-America who wish to develop their original feature film fiction scripts. Applicants must be over 18 years old and proficient in Spanish. The residency offers a comprehensive experience, including workshops, masterclasses, one-on-one mentoring, and a final project pitch. To apply, participants must submit a motivational letter, biofilmography, a script synopsis, and a script outline. The cost for international participants is $1,750 USD, while Peruvian participants pay $1,500 USD. The program lasts two weeks and covers accommodation, meals, transportation, health insurance, and post-program mentoring. The application period is from April 1 to May 13, 2025.
